What statement is the best example of a symbolic-interaction approach to the purpose of education?

A symbolic-interaction approach to education might emphasize that the purpose of education is to provide individuals with the tools and knowledge to create their own reality through interaction with others in society. This approach would focus on how individuals interpret and give meaning to their educational experiences in shaping their identities and social interactions.

Who developed social interaction theory?

Social Interaction Theory was developed by George Herbert Mead, a sociologist and philosopher. Mead emphasized the importance of social interaction and communication in shaping individual identities and understanding society. His work laid the foundation for the symbolic interactionist approach in sociology.

Which approach focuses on how society is experienced and how individual behavior changes from one situation to another?

The symbolic interactionist approach focuses on how society is experienced and how individual behavior changes from one situation to another. It emphasizes the importance of symbols, meanings, and interactions in shaping social life. This approach highlights the role of communication and interpretation in shaping individual behavior within different social contexts.
